Start With Something Genuinely Evergreen Instead of chasing trending, hype-driven products, I looked for something with steady, ongoing demand — a product people would search for regardless of season or trend cycles. Car and home cleaning accessories fit this well: people need to clean their car interiors and homes year-round, not just during a specific season or trend wave. The trade-off with evergreen products is that they're usually more saturated — more sellers are already competing for the same buyer. I decided that predictable, ongoing demand was worth the extra competition, rather than betting on a trendy product that might disappear in a few months.
